Summary
Hackensack's noise ordinance treats a building's own air conditioners and HVAC equipment as a potential sound source under Chapter 112, even when the receiving property is on the same lot. Where a multiuse or multi-dwelling property has an outdoor HVAC unit, § 112-2 draws the enforceable property line at the exterior wall of the affected unit, and the general sound level limits in § 112-7 apply at that line.
REAL PROPERTY LINE Either (a) the vertical boundary that separates one parcel of property (i.e., lot and block) from another residential or commercial property; (b) the vertical and horizontal boundaries of a dwelling unit that is part of a multi-dwelling-unit building; or (c) on a multiuse property as defined herein, the vertical or horizontal boundaries between the two portions of the property on which different categories of activity are being performed (e.g., if the multiuse property is a building which is residential upstairs and commercial downstairs, then the real property line would be the interface between the residential area and the commercial area, or if there is an outdoor sound source such as an HVAC unit on the same parcel of property, the boundary line is the exterior wall of the receiving unit).

Full Breakdown
Chapter 112 does not carve out a separate decibel table for air conditioners or HVAC systems; instead it folds them into its general definitions and lets the citywide sound level limits in § 112-7 do the work. Section 112-2's definition of "multiuse property" lists air conditioners by name, alongside boilers, incinerators, elevators, automatic garage doors and laundry rooms, as examples of building equipment that can be a source of elevated sound levels at another category on the same parcel, meaning a commercial unit's rooftop condenser can be a code issue against the residential unit above or beside it even though both sit on one lot.
Because ordinary property-line noise rules assume the source and the receiver are on different lots, § 112-2's definition of "real property line" spells out where the line falls when they are not: on a mixed residential-and-commercial building it is the interface between the two uses, and if there is an outdoor sound source such as an HVAC unit on the same parcel of property, the boundary line is drawn at the exterior wall of the receiving unit. That means a tenant disturbed by a neighboring unit's HVAC condenser can invoke the same maximum permissible sound levels set out in § 112-7 and Tables I through III, measured at their own exterior wall rather than at a lot line that does not exist between two units in the same building.
A Noise Control Officer or Investigator enforces this the same way as any other noise complaint, using the measurement protocol in § 112-6 and, if warranted, a notice of violation or penalty assessment under § 112-11.
Violations & Fines
An HVAC or air conditioning unit that pushes sound above the Table I-III limits at the affected property's real property line is enforced like any other Chapter 112 violation: a Noise Control Officer or Investigator can issue a notice of violation for a minor, first-time issue or a notice of penalty assessment carrying a civil fine of up to $2,000 per day under § 112-11B for a repeat or purposeful violation.
